All race tables below use 2d6. Any driver that can not pay the wear called for on any table spins unless other results indicate that the car should crash.

Deceleration Chart
Over byPenalty
20mphUse 1 wear, or test brakes
40mphUse 2 wear, or use 1 wear and test brakes
60mphUse 2 wear and test brakes
80mph +Use 3 wear and test brakes and spin
Cornering Chart
Over byPenalty
20mphUse 1 wear, or consult chance table
40mphUse 2 wear, or use 1 wear and consult chance table
60mphUse 2 wear and consult chance table
80mph +Crash off course: out of race

Acceleration/Top Speed Test Table (skill chips)
DRResult
2-9Gain 20 mph this turn only
10-12Fail, replot 20 mph below attempted speed;
Engine Damage, -20 mph to tested catagory;
Engine Failure if second damage, out of race
Start Speed Test Table (skill chips)
DRResult
2-8Gain 20 mph this turn only
9Mis-shift, replot 40 mph below attempted speed
10-12Stall, replot at 0 mph;
Engine Damage, -20 mph to acceleration;
Engine Failure if second damage, out of race

Brakes Test Table (skill chips)
DRResult
2-9Safely decelerated
10-12Fail, use 1 wear;
Brake Damage, -20 mph to deceleration;
Brake Failure if second damage, out of race
Chance Table (skill chips)
DRResult
2-6Safely driven
7-9Spin
10-12Crash on course: out of race

Passing Table (skill chips)
+2 for each immediatly previous forced pass
DRResult
2-5Successful pass
6-9Unsuccessful pass
10-12Unsuccessful pass with contact: passer and passee both lose 2 wear
